mirror of
https://github.com/Artikash/Textractor.git
synced 2025-01-10 17:49:14 +08:00
clarify text
This commit is contained in:
parent
faeda02f2b
commit
b28aa3d189
@ -10,7 +10,7 @@
|
|||||||
extern const char* CHROME_LOCATION;
|
extern const char* CHROME_LOCATION;
|
||||||
extern const char* START_DEVTOOLS;
|
extern const char* START_DEVTOOLS;
|
||||||
extern const char* STOP_DEVTOOLS;
|
extern const char* STOP_DEVTOOLS;
|
||||||
extern const char* HEADLESS_MODE;
|
extern const char* HIDE_CHROME;
|
||||||
extern const char* DEVTOOLS_STATUS;
|
extern const char* DEVTOOLS_STATUS;
|
||||||
extern const char* AUTO_START;
|
extern const char* AUTO_START;
|
||||||
|
|
||||||
@ -119,14 +119,14 @@ namespace DevTools
|
|||||||
display->addRow(CHROME_LOCATION, chromePathEdit);
|
display->addRow(CHROME_LOCATION, chromePathEdit);
|
||||||
auto headlessCheck = new QCheckBox();
|
auto headlessCheck = new QCheckBox();
|
||||||
auto startButton = new QPushButton(START_DEVTOOLS), stopButton = new QPushButton(STOP_DEVTOOLS);
|
auto startButton = new QPushButton(START_DEVTOOLS), stopButton = new QPushButton(STOP_DEVTOOLS);
|
||||||
headlessCheck->setChecked(settings.value(HEADLESS_MODE, true).toBool());
|
headlessCheck->setChecked(settings.value(HIDE_CHROME, true).toBool());
|
||||||
QObject::connect(headlessCheck, &QCheckBox::clicked, [](bool headless) { settings.setValue(HEADLESS_MODE, headless); });
|
QObject::connect(headlessCheck, &QCheckBox::clicked, [](bool headless) { settings.setValue(HIDE_CHROME, headless); });
|
||||||
QObject::connect(startButton, &QPushButton::clicked, [chromePathEdit, headlessCheck] { Start(S(chromePathEdit->text()), headlessCheck->isChecked()); });
|
QObject::connect(startButton, &QPushButton::clicked, [chromePathEdit, headlessCheck] { Start(S(chromePathEdit->text()), headlessCheck->isChecked()); });
|
||||||
QObject::connect(stopButton, &QPushButton::clicked, &Close);
|
QObject::connect(stopButton, &QPushButton::clicked, &Close);
|
||||||
auto buttons = new QHBoxLayout();
|
auto buttons = new QHBoxLayout();
|
||||||
buttons->addWidget(startButton);
|
buttons->addWidget(startButton);
|
||||||
buttons->addWidget(stopButton);
|
buttons->addWidget(stopButton);
|
||||||
display->addRow(HEADLESS_MODE, headlessCheck);
|
display->addRow(HIDE_CHROME, headlessCheck);
|
||||||
auto autoStartCheck = new QCheckBox();
|
auto autoStartCheck = new QCheckBox();
|
||||||
autoStartCheck->setChecked(settings.value(AUTO_START, false).toBool());
|
autoStartCheck->setChecked(settings.value(AUTO_START, false).toBool());
|
||||||
QObject::connect(autoStartCheck, &QCheckBox::clicked, [](bool autoStart) { settings.setValue(AUTO_START, autoStart); });
|
QObject::connect(autoStartCheck, &QCheckBox::clicked, [](bool autoStart) { settings.setValue(AUTO_START, autoStart); });
|
||||||
|
2
text.cpp
2
text.cpp
@ -150,7 +150,7 @@ const char* API_KEY = u8"API key";
|
|||||||
const char* CHROME_LOCATION = u8"Google Chrome file location";
|
const char* CHROME_LOCATION = u8"Google Chrome file location";
|
||||||
const char* START_DEVTOOLS = u8"Start DevTools";
|
const char* START_DEVTOOLS = u8"Start DevTools";
|
||||||
const char* STOP_DEVTOOLS = u8"Stop DevTools";
|
const char* STOP_DEVTOOLS = u8"Stop DevTools";
|
||||||
const char* HEADLESS_MODE = u8"Headless mode";
|
const char* HIDE_CHROME = u8"Hide Chrome window";
|
||||||
const char* DEVTOOLS_STATUS = u8"DevTools status";
|
const char* DEVTOOLS_STATUS = u8"DevTools status";
|
||||||
const char* AUTO_START = u8"Start automatically";
|
const char* AUTO_START = u8"Start automatically";
|
||||||
const wchar_t* ERROR_START_CHROME = L"failed to start Chrome or to connect to it";
|
const wchar_t* ERROR_START_CHROME = L"failed to start Chrome or to connect to it";
|
||||||
|
Loading…
x
Reference in New Issue
Block a user